WHY ? ? IMPORTANCE OF REFERENCE CHECKING ü ü ü ü Protects and lowers the risk to the organization Contributes to overall performance Supports retention Confirms impressions about candidate Investigate concerns raised during interview process Substantiate or discredit claims made by candidate Gather performance related information Requirement of employment

WHEN ? A. Prior to the interview Expedites selection B. After the interview but

WHEN ? A. Prior to the interview Expedites selection B. After the interview but prior to the offer Traditional process C. After the interview and after the conditional offer Expedites hiring

PREPARATION 1. 2. 3. 4. 5. 6. 7. . Gather the necessary information Understand job requirements/competencies Carefully review resumes and application form Look for gaps and overlaps in work experience and/or unrealistic and vague qualifications Be familiar with the outcome of the interview(s) Prepare questions using the Reference Form as a guide Contact references and ensure that timing is good

QUESTIONING TECHNIQUES 1. 2. Behavioural or competency based questions will help assess potential performance in areas such as: • Leadership • Problem solving • Critical thinking • Handling stress/conflict • Self-directed Technical or performance related questions such as: • • • Computers, software, hardware, programs… Counselling skills Attendance record Clinical knowledge Overall performance

HOW ? Hello? Conduct Check n n n Set aside time in a private area – no interruptions Confirm time is convenient for referee Ensure confidentiality Listen for inconsistencies, gather specific examples Document results ensuring objectivity Sign and Date

Beginning the Call 1. 2. 3. 4. 5. 6. 7. Ask for the referee by name and verify title Clearly introduce yourself by name, title, organization State purpose of call Briefly outline job and requirements Allow the referee to call back if needed, provide time options Ask questions Document information provided

KEY TIPS Did you know…. • Resumé falsifying is on the rise and so is the importance of recruitment awareness. • Almost 90% of HR directors surveyed by the SHRM reported resume untruths ranging from past salaries to personal identification. • While education credentials can be verified with a simple phone call to the school, work-related investigations require a little (and sometimes a lot), more sleuthing.
